You are bidding on one Debt and mortgage bonds, negotiated on the 5th. November 1862 at the Lützen district court.


Raisin Elisabeth Simon, b. Lungwitz, wife of the master tanner Johann Carl Simon in Lützen, borrows from the Sparkasse Lützen the sum of 60 thalers. As security, she gives a specified field property in Lützener Flur as a mortgage.


Issued by the Lützen District Court Commission on June 6th. November 1862.


One follows Authorization of the Sparkasse Board of Trustees “for the loan of a capital of 60 thalers,” dated Lützen, 6. November 1862.

Signed “Kloß” and “Goldberg”.


At the end one Extract from the Lützen mortgage book from 6. November 1862.


Scope: 8 of 10 pages described (32.5 x 20 cm).


Marginal notes on the first page; among other things, about the deletion of the mortgage (Lützen District Court, 30. May 1922). -- The document is marked with incisions to indicate deletion.
